A premium, multi-material adventure touring boot the Corozal is packed with class-leading protective features, such as an advanced polymer shin plate and innovative lateral ankle protection with supporting biomechanical link between the upper boot and the lower foot structure. Every component on this boot is designed for weight-saving and performance regardless of the weather or terrain, from the integrated DRYSTAR breathable membrane to its advanced microfiber and suede chassis.
CONSTRUCTION
Multi-material upper chassis incorporating PU-coated leather, microfiber and suede leather for excellent levels of comfort, durability and abrasion resistance.
Extensive front and lower rear accordion flex zones constructed from lightweight and durable microfiber for comfort, freedom of movement, control and support.
Medial surface stamped suede panel for improved grip and protection.
Innovative lateral ankle protection with biomechanical blade-link between the upper boot and the lower foot structure.
TPU shift pad with specially designed patterning for improved grip.
Lightweight, advanced polymer shin-plate and lateral ankle protections offer impact and resistance as well as structural support.
Internal toe box and heel counter protection is layered under the upper for durability, improved feel and performance.
Medial and lateral dual density ankle protector disk is subtly incorporated into boot chassis and offers strategic ankle protection.
NEW BUCKLE CLOSURE SYSTEM: New system allows for easy and rapid in/out, plus a secure and highly personalized closure. The buckles are made from durable TPU and glass fibre reinforced Nylon compounds for greater performance and weight-saving. All buckles include a micro-ratchet memory system and quick-release/locking for a quick, safe and precise closure. All buckles are replaceable.
Wide-entry aperture opening of easy in and out, plus secure upper TPR and Velcro closure system to allow for a wide-range of calf fit adjustment.
